AT&T Samsung Gear Smart Watches Release: Pre-Oders Begin Friday

Mar 20, 2014 03:35 PM EDT | By Justin Stock

Consumers can pre-order the Samsung Gear 2, Samsung Gear 2 Neo, and Samsung Gear Fit online or at AT&T retail locations when the mobile carrier initiates their availability Friday.

According to a press release on AT&T's website, the Gear 2 and Gear 2 Neo have a 1.63 inch Super AMOLED display with bands that can be adjusted, and used with 22 millimeter pin watch bands in many colors.

"The Gear products are a great addition to our already strong lineup of wearable devices that meet your needs while on-the-go," Jeff Bradley, senior vice president for Devices at AT&T said in a statement. "AT&T elevates mobility to the next level. Pair the Samsung Galaxy S 5 with Gear wearables for a great value that you can take anywhere and fits your lifestyle."

The gadgets can handle dust if and when users go for a hike, and fend off water if they are at the beach. Consumers can also measure their heart rate.

The devices can also make calls and transmit text messages when users utilize it with a Samsung galaxy smartphone the press release reported.

The watches also handle automatic notifications, and music capabilities that allow consumers to hear songs via the smartphone.

One new change is the re-location of the two megapixel camera on the Gear 2 to the front of the watch.

The Gear 2 costs $299 with the Gear 2 Neo and Gear Fit slated for $100 less at $199 before taxes.

Those interested in the Samsung Galaxy S5 can buy one from an AT&T retail location and receive a $50 discount on the smart watches the press release reported.

AT&T plans to send out orders for the smart watches in April.

Information on smart watches from Verizon, T-Mobile, and Sprint are not yet available The Los Angeles Times reported.
